IDF Female Officer: ISIS Terrified of Being Defeated by Women

By Tzvi Ben-Gedalyahu

|

November 20, 2015, 9 AM ET

The IDF may have the most terrifying weapon to use against the Islamic State (ISIS) - women.

The co-ed Caracal Battalion is deployed at the Israeli border with Egypt's Sinai Peninsula, where the Islamic State (ISIS) has claimed dozens of terrorist attacks, the latest being the bombed Russian airplane that was blown up shortly after taking from the Sharm-el-Sheikh airport in the Sinai.

Caracal commander Lt. "Ada" says"

I’m not afraid to confront terrorists if necessary. ISIS fighters are terrified of being defeated by a woman; it completely contradicts their radical beliefs.
The Caracal Battalion is responsible for defending the volatile Israel-Sinai border. Established in 2004, it was the first battalion to fully integrate women as combat soldiers. The battalion is trained to deal with terrorist infiltrations, bombs on the border, shootings, smuggling and crime. Lt. Ada adds:
After the Russian plane went down, we realized how tangible the threat has become. My soldiers need to know that we are here to stand up against terrorism."
